The posttransplant lymphoproliferative disease is a severe cause of morbidity and mortality following allogeneic hematopoietic stem cell transplantation. Central Nervous System involvement in EBV-related PTLD is rare, and there is no standard treatment recommendation. We present our patient and discuss other previously reported cases of EBV-associated PTLD with CNS involvement.

Background: Breast cancer is a heterogeneous disease and differences in the expression levels of the ER, PR, and HER2 the triplet of established biomarkers used for clinical decision-making have been reported among breast cancer patients. Furthermore, resistance to anti-estrogen and anti-HER2 therapies emerges in a considerable rate of breast cancer patients, and novel drug therapies are required. Several anomalous signaling pathways have been known in breast cancer have been known; heat shock protein 90 (HSP90) is one of the most plenty proteins in breast cells. The family of ubiquitin ligases such as SIAH1 and SIAH2 is known to specifically target misfolded proteins to the proteasome; also, they have been illustrated to play a role in RAS signaling and as an essential downstream signaling component required for EGFR/HER2 in breast cancer. Methods: The expression of SIAH2, HSP90, and HER2 was assessed by quantitative Real-Time PCR in 85 invasive ductal carcinoma breast tumor samples at Uludag University Hospital in Turkey during the years 2018-2019, and its association with the clinicopathologic variables of patients was evaluated. Results: HSP90, SIAH1, and SIAH2 were significantly (P=0.0271, P=0.022, and P=0.0311) upregulated tumor tissue of patients with breast cancer. Moreover, this study observed a significant association between the high expression of SIAH2/HSP90 with ER status, high expression of HSP90 with Recurrence/Metastasis, and high expression of SIAH2 with Ki-67 proliferation index. Conclusion: The HSP90 and SIAH2 expressions play a significant role in breast cancer development by combining the experimental and clinical data obtained from the literature.

BACKGROUND: Clear cell type renal cell carcinoma (ccRCC) is the most common renal cell carcinoma (RCC). In this study, we examined the expressions of VHL and miR-223 in ccRCC patients׳ tissues to investigate the possible role in the development of ccRCC. METHODS AND RESULTS: This study collected five expression profiles (GSE36139, GSE3, GSE73731, GSE40435, and GSE26032) from Gene Omnibus Data. Expressions of VHL and miR-223 in paraffinized tumor and normal tissues of 100 Turkish patients' ccRCC tissues were determined by bioinformatic data mining and real-time quantitative polymerase chain reaction (qRT-PCR). The VHL gene was subjected to mutational analysis by DNA sequencing, and pVHL was analyzed using western blotting. Our study's t-test and Pearson correlation analysis showed that VHL gene expression in tumoral tissues with a - 0.39-fold decrease was not significantly lower than normal tissues (p = 0.441), and a 0.97-fold increase miR-223 (p = 0.045) was determined by real-time PCR. Also, as a result of DNA sequence analysis performed in the VHL gene, it was found that 26% of the patients have mutations. The mutations for (VHL):c.60C>A (p.Val20=) and (VHL):c.467delA (p.Tyr156Leu) was detected for the first time in Turkish patients. CONCLUSIONS: The present study demonstrated that the differences in the expression levels of miR-223 have the potential to be biomarkers to determine the poor prognosis in ccRCC.

PURPOSE: Upregulation of N-cadherin in epithelial tumor cells has been reported to enhance the invasive process. Although the distribution of N-cadherin in the normal testis was demonstrated, there is no adequate information regarding its presence in testicular germ cell tumors (GCTs). Our purpose was to examine the expression and localization of N-cadherin in germ cell tumors of the testis and share our experience. METHODS: 104 adult cases of primary and metastatic testicular GCTs, 5 germ cell neoplasia in situ and 15 benign testicular tissues were included into the study and analyzed for immunoexpression of N-cadherin. Positive expression was evaluated according to intensity and localization of the staining. RESULTS: In 34 pure seminomas, 6 seminomas of mixed component and 16 metastatic seminomas, N-cadherin expression was observed with variable staining intensity. Two pure yolk sac tumors and 20 out of 34 mixed GCTs with yolk sac components were positive for N-cadherin. In contrast, neither the embryonal and chorionic carcinomas nor the teratomas showed N-cadherin expression. CONCLUSIONS: N-cadherin immunexpression should be interpreted considering both staining intensity and extent. In case of a metastatic tumor of unknown primary showing prominent N-cadherin expression, seminoma should be considered in the differential diagnosis. At the same time Ncadherin staining could be used to differentiate seminomas from embryonal carcinomas with solid components in metastatic GCTs, both having similar histopathological findings. On the other hand, the diagnostic value is not obvious for nonseminomatous tumors.

Vasculitis is relatively uncommon in lymphoproliferative disease and may predate the diagnosis of lymphoproliferative disease. Many vasculitides have been associated with hairy cell leukemia (HCL), including polyarteritis nodosa (PAN) and leukocytoclastic vasculitis. We herein report a case whose initial presentation was like Behçet's disease (BD) (arthritis, oral and genital ulcerations, papulopustular skin lesions) in addition to pancytopenia, but turned out to have HCL. Because of the overlap between their symptoms, like oral ulcerations, skin lesions, arthritis and constitutional findings, HCL and BD may mimic each other. We should keep in mind other reasons for vasculitis such as lymphoproliferative disease, especially whose who have hematological abnormalities such as pancytopenia.
